As an Israeli-American Jew raising young children in our wonderfully diverse borough, recent displays of Palestinian flags have sparked a mix of emotions within me. While I love raising my family here, these symbols have instilled a genuine fear and made me question if Tower Hamlets is a safe place for Jews.
Symbols like Palestinian flags, in a complex geopolitical context, can carry deep historical and emotional weight. Streets lined with them feel designed to intimidate a minority population rather than show solidarity with another.
Though I typically embrace sharing my background, I hate to say that these days I do not want people to find out that I’m Jewish or have lived in Israel, because I’m afraid of how they would react.
